MRWA Zero Waste Strategy 2025

The Zero Waste Strategy for Merseyside Recycling and Waste Authority (MRWA) presents a bold, future-focused vision for cutting waste and reducing carbon emissions across the Liverpool City Region. Recognising the global impact of wasted resources on climate change, the Strategy outlines both the responsibility and the opportunity to rethink how materials are used and valued.
